The S.M.J. Railway operated some of the most unprofitable lines in England—from Blisworth to Banbury and Stratford-on-Avon—with a remarkable collection of locomotives and rolling stock. Trains were infrequent, and passengers were few; and, as Mr. Dunn writes: " Its history, in places as elusive as the line itself, is a curious example of the survival of the unfit." This is the first full-length account of the S.M.J. to be published, and it brings the story of its lines down to 1952. It is based on much original research, and the railway's strange collection of locomotives is fully described.

With Eighteen Illustrations; a Map; and a Complete Table of Locomotives
